About Lancaster Bible College
Empowering Christian leaders since 1933, offering faith-integrated academics for impact.
Lancaster Bible College (LBC) stands as a beacon for students dedicated to integrating faith with rigorous academics. Founded in 1933 by Henry J. Heydt as the Lancaster School of the Bible, LBC has a rich history of preparing individuals for lives of Christian service and leadership. Its journey from a foundational Bible school to a comprehensive college reflects a steady commitment to its core mission, culminating in its move to the current Manheim Township campus in 1957 and its adoption of the Lancaster Bible College name in 1973.
Prospective students will find LBC's academic strengths rooted in its diverse program offerings. The college received official approval in 1981 to offer the Bachelor of Science in Bible degree, laying a robust foundation for undergraduate studies. Expanding its educational reach, LBC's graduate school was approved in 1994, providing Master of Arts degrees in Bible, Ministry, and Counseling, as well as Master of Education degrees in School Counseling and Consulting Resource Teacher, catering to various professional and ministry callings.
The student experience at LBC is shaped by its distinct Christian identity. While fostering a vibrant community, the college operates under a Title IX exception granted in 2016, which permits it to maintain religious standards concerning LGBT students. Under the leadership of President Thomas L. Kiedis, who began his tenure in 2020, LBC continues to evolve, exemplified by the integration of its former Philadelphia site's offerings into its extensive online programming, ensuring accessibility to its unique educational philosophy.
